vinous

English

/ˈvaɪnəs/

adj
Definitions
  • Pertaining to or having the characteristics of wine.
  • Tending to drink wine excessively.
  • Affected by the drinking of wine.

Etymology

Inherited from Middle English vinous derived from Latin vīnōsus (wine-flavoured, fond of wine).
